HONG KONG ACADEMY OF MEDICINE ORDINANCE - SECT 13

Bylaws

(1) The Council may, subject to subsection (3), make bylaws, not inconsistent
with this Ordinance.

(2) Without affecting the generality of subsection (1), the Council may by
bylaw-

   (a)  provide for the requirements, including qualifications, experience or
        training, for admission to various categories of membership of the
        Academy;

   (b)  provide for the creation or specification of categories of membership
        referred to in section 3(3)(a)(iv) and the relevant qualifications for
        admission;

   (c)  provide for the procedure for admission of members of the Academy;

   (d)  specify the fees (if any) for membership of the Academy and the manner
        of payment of such fees;

   (e)  provide for the resignation from membership of the Academy and
        termination of such membership, including the grounds therefor, the
        periodic review of membership and any requirement relating to
        continuing medical education and training;

   (f)  specify particulars of academic awards and distinctions, specialist
        designations or certifications to be awarded by the Academy and
        provide for matters relating to their grant, conferment or revocation;

   (g)  provide for the emblem of the Academy, the design of the seal of the
        Academy and the custody of the seal;

   (h)  provide for the academic dress of the members of the Academy and
        Academy Colleges;

   (i)  provide for the welfare and the conduct of the members of the Academy
        and its employees;

   (j)  provide for powers, functions, rights and duties of the members of the
        Council;

   (k)  provide for the recognition of and withdrawal of recognition from
        Academy Colleges or Faculties including the procedure therefor and
        grounds for such withdrawal and guidelines applicable to
        Academy Colleges and Faculties; and

   (l)  specify financial procedures.

(3) Except in the case of a bylaw made during the interim period, any bylaw
made under subsection (1) shall be of no force or effect until it is approved
by not less than 1/2 of the Fellows in a postal ballot in which not less than
1/5 of such Fellows have voted.

(4) The Honorary Secretary of the Academy referred to in section  9 (5)(d)
shall cause a copy of any bylaw made, and where applicable, approved under
this section, to be sent to each member of the Academy or the Council as soon
as reasonably practicable after it is made.

(5) Section 34 of the Interpretation and General Clauses Ordinance ( Cap 1)
shall not apply as regards any bylaw made under this section. (Enacted 1992)
